Ядро базы данных Joomla 3. Таблицы ядра базы данных Joomla 3

Ядро базы данных Joomla 3. Таблицы ядра базы данных Joomla 3

В данной небольшой статье дизайн студия «Движок» в табличном виде покажет ядро базы данных сайта который был сделан на CMS Joomla 3. То есть за что отвечает та или иная таблица в базе данных. Это может быть полезным.

Joomla 3 может работать не только с СУБД MySQL 5.1 +, но и с базами MSSQL 10.50.1600.1 +, Postgre SQL 8.3.18 +.
Администратор сайта и группа разрешенных пользователей имеют доступ к таблицам ядра базы данных через приложение phpMyAdmin, установленное на сервере хостинга. Для входа в phpMyAdmin используется имя пользователя БД и пароль доступа, которые задаются при создании базы данных.

Ядро базы данных

Ядро базы данных содержит 68 таблиц. База данных поддерживает основные функции сайта на стороне front-end и back-end сайта. В таблицах базы хранится динамический контент сайта, который часто меняется и обновляется. Адрес базы данных, как правило, localhost, но может и быть конкретный адрес, типа, логин. идентификатор .mysql.

Таблицы ядра базы данных Joomla 3

Следующая таблица описывает таблицы ядра базы данных Joomla 3.2.

Приложение

Подчиненное приложение

Таблица базы

Материалы

Менеджер материалов

#_content -Материалы
#_content_rating – Материалыврейтинге

#_contentitem_tag_map

Менеджер разделов

#_categories   

Менеджер Главной страницы

#_content_frontpage

Расширения

Компоненты

#_extensions 

Менеджер шаблонов

Не существует таблицы в базые данных, в которой перечисляются доступные шаблоны. Список формируется по содержимому каталога templates.

Менеджер языков

#_languages         

Компоненты

Баннеры

#_banners -Все баннеры сайта.                      

#_banner_clients – Размещенные баннеры.

#_banner_tracks – Каналы банеров.             

Ленты новостей

#_newsfeeds

Интелектуальный поиск

Таблицы #_finder_ 

Поиск



#_core_log_searches

Сообщения

#_messages 
#_messages_cfg

Сайт

Пользователи

#_users – Все пользователи.
#_session – Все рабочие сессии.

#_usergroups – Группы пользователей.        

 #_user_keys – Пароли пользователей.                     

 #_user_notes – Заметки о пользователях.

 #_user_profiles – Принадлежность пользователя к группе.         

 #_user_usergroup_map – Таблица соответствий пользователя и группы.         

Медиа менеджер

Не существует таблицы в базе данных для медиа менеджера. Медиа менеджер создает список доступных медиа объектов на основе содержимого определенных каталогов.

Общие настройки

Общие настройки сайта хранятся в файле configuration.php. Для общих настроек нет таблицы в базе данных. ДанныеБДв configuration.php:

var $host = '';
var $user = '';
var $password = '';

Журнал регистрации и статистика

#_core_log_searches 

Меню

#_menu — Всепунктыменюсайта (back-end + front-end).
#_menu_types – Менюback-end. 

#_associations – Соответствие пунктов меню языковой локализации.

UCM

Unified Content Model

Единаямодельсодержимого

#_ucm_base

#_ucm_content                     

#_ucm_history

Префикс таблиц в Joomla 3

Префикс базы данных генерируется автоматом при установке joomla 3 или указывается самостоятельно. Префикс должен содержать цифры и латинские буквы. Длина префикса 3-4 знака (рекомендовано). При смене префикса на рабочем сайте не забываем поменять префикс в файле configuration.php:

var $db = ''; (Имя базы данных)
var $dbprefix = ''; (Префикс базы данных).

Вот и все, если Вы хотите «поблагодарить» наше IT сообщество — у вас есть такая возможность: справа есть варианты для пожертвований на развитие портала. Или поделитесь статьей в ваших соц.сетях через сервис ниже.

Источник

Отправить ответ

Please Login to comment
Войти с помощью: 
  Subscribe  
Notify of
Authorization
*
*
Войти с помощью: 
Registration
*
*
*
Войти с помощью: 

14 + 1 =

Password generation